About Adrian Quesada

📖 Summary

Adrian Quesada is a multi-talented musician, producer, and songwriter with a diverse and impressive body of work. With a career spanning over two decades, Quesada has made significant contributions to the music industry, working across a variety of genres and collaborating with numerous high-profile artists. His skillful musicianship, innovative production techniques, and commitment to pushing boundaries have earned him widespread recognition and respect in the industry.

Quesada is best known for his work as a founding member of the Grammy-winning Latin funk and psychedelic soul band, Grupo Fantasma. As the guitarist for the group, he has played a pivotal role in shaping their signature sound, blending elements of cumbia, salsa, and rock to create a unique and electrifying musical experience. Grupo Fantasma's dynamic live performances and critically acclaimed albums have solidified their status as one of the most influential bands in the Latin music scene, earning them a dedicated global fan base and numerous accolades.

Why are they called the Black Pumas?

Soon enough, the duo had a name, Black Pumas, inspired by Quesada's fascination with jaguars (his studio has a jaguar logo) and a play on the Black Panthers. The moment of creative truth came on stage, when they debuted their act at an Austin club.Jan 21, 2020
